A known option which can be used to offer medical help for poor sleep is through maintaining a healthy weight. Obese people always suffer from slow breaths since the airways have been blocked by the extra fats which are located on the neck. Having an abnormal weight does not only cause sleep apnea but also other related effects such as cardiovascular diseases. Therefore, people ought to be careful with the foods they take and the nature of their lifestyles as well.

The other way which can be used to offer medical assistance to an individual is by advising them to stop the abuse of some drugs such as alcohol and sedatives. This is due to the effect they have on the air passage routes making it hard to control the breathing since the throat muscles are affected. This is considered a natural remedy which is highly advised. Smokers are advised to quit stopping at all cost. This will also reduce the inflammation experienced in abuse.

The other option which can also be used to treat the disorder is through surgical procedures. This may never be a guarantee all will go as planned. However, it is the best option for people who do not benefit from CPAP. There is some information a patient must know before making the choice. Be sure to make inquiries on aspects such as how effective the procedure is, the side effects and risks involved. Find an experienced doctor and facility to undergo the surgery process.

Positional therapy is yet another remedy which can be used by an individual to treat sleep apnea. There are individuals who will experience poor sleep when they sleep on their backs. Therefore, they have to be trained on how to use their side instead. There are devices individuals can wear around the back or waist. This helps in maintaining the right position while resting.

Less congestion and less snoring are among the benefits some individuals enjoy from sleeping in rooms which have a humidifier. Hence it is necessary to consider humidifying the place before going for a nap. The other way can be through rubbing natural oils such as eucalyptus on the chest which causing soothing to a stuffy throat or nose.

Tracheostomy is highly recommended when a person goes through extreme obstructive sleep apnea. This means a doctor will have to make a hole on the windpipe and a breathing pipe inserted. This is to ensure they acquire enough air when they experience difficulties at night.
